I had a question about stacking savebreaks.

I know that savebreaks from equipment are winner takes all and not cumulative, but is it the same for spells?

For instance, lightning shield offers +4 afflictive break. If I'm wearing eq that gives +10, is that net +14 or again only the highest, +10?

And if I have two spells that offer savebreak, are those cumulative, or again exclusive?

Savebreaks are completely exclusive. Your character uses the highest break from a single source.

is it right to assume that spells that don't have a dependency mentioned in their help files are affected in some way by save break anyway?

To illustrate for illusionists--a spell like 'dreamstruck' clearly does not depend on save break as mentioned in its help file, whereas a spell like 'colour spray' has its dependency listed as 'very high.' Other spells like 'misdirection' do not have their relationship to dependency listed in the help file, but would it be right to assume that a save break would have some impact?

You can think of wearing a savebreak item as a way to effectively negate some of your opponents' saves. When a dependency is listed for a spell, it means savebreak influences the spell in some additional way and should be outlined for you in the spell's helpfile. That might include the amount of damage the spell does, like acid blast, or some other affect, like vampiric touch healing.
